LIVING IN SHARED ACCOMMODATION
Please check out the NHS link for the very latest advice.
If you live in shared accommodation (for example, university halls of residence):
- stay in your room with the door closed, only using communal kitchens, bathrooms and living areas when necessary
- avoid using a shared kitchen while others are using it
- take your meals back to your room to eat
- use a dishwasher (if available) to clean and dry your used crockery and cutlery; if this is not possible, wash them by hand using detergent and warm water and dry them thoroughly, using a separate tea towel
WHAT IF I DEVELOP SYMPTOMS?
If you get a cough, a fever or shortness of breath, call NHS 111 and tell them you have been asked to self-isolate because of coronavirus. Even if the symptoms seem mild, it is better to call for advice.
